For the 2025 school year, there are 6 private preschools serving 1,254 students in Jackson County, MI.
The top ranked private preschools in Jackson County, MI include Trinity Lutheran School, Queen Of The Miraculous Medal School, and St. John The Evangelist Elementary School.
The average acceptance rate is 95%, which is higher than the Michigan private preschool average acceptance rate of 89%.

How diverse are private preschools in Jackson County?
Jackson County private preschools are approximately 12% minority students, which is lower than the Michigan private school average of 18%.
